Administrative history
The Vitcoria General Hospital were in the decision of the City of Halifax to build a hospital that was completed in 1859. Various problems delayed the delivery of health care and it wasn't until April of 1867 when the first patient was received in the restructured Provincial and City Hospital - a jointg body of the two levels of government. In 1887 the Province assumed total responsiblity for the Hospital which was also renamed, in the year of Royal Jubilee, as the Victoira General Hospital. Consolidation of most Halifax hospitals under one administration happened in 1994 and the Victoria General Hospital became a site under the Queen Elizabeth II Health Science Centre.
Custodial history
Records were donated to the Dalhousie University Archives by A.V. Earle, son of Richard William Lawrence Earle, in accession (12-91) in 1991, along with eight photographs that appear to have been transferred to PC1 and added to the Kellogg Library Photograph Collection.
